Hey team — the Parcelhawk tracking webhook went quiet again last night, and this time it's not the carrier's fault. The credentials we minted for the Wrenlock ingestion service expired on Sunday and nobody caught the calendar reminder. Deliveries are still scanning fine; we're just not pushing status updates to customers. I've minted a fresh credential and confirmed events are flowing again in staging. Use the replacement key below when you redeploy the webhook worker.

service key, fafop-kaguf: vxb7-m3DSNYe

Onboarding: tracing at Nimbrel

Hey reviewer — quick primer: every request through our microservices carries a trace header minted at the Gatewren edge. Follow it across the cart, pricing, and ledger services to spot dropped spans. To open the archived trace vault during review, you'll need the recovery passphrase given just below.

strongbox words: alddor-rusius-belox-gorys-holius-oliix-ralmir-lamvan-briius-fraion-zormir-novwyn-zormir-holmir

## Formula sandbox tuning

User-supplied formulas in Gridmoor execute inside a restricted interpreter with hard ceilings on time, memory, and call depth. Reviewers should confirm any change to these ceilings is justified in the PR description, since raising them widens the abuse surface. Defaults were chosen from production traces. The current limits are as follows.

limits module of tafog-fawip:
WEIGHTS = {
    "julix": 57,
    "lamys": 992,
    "kasvan": 209,
    "quenok": 750,
    "alddor": 259,
    "oliath": 1009,
    "wenix": 815,
}

## Runbook: Pondera API — N+1 query fix

If customers report slow profile pages, confirm the batching loader is enabled. The fix groups related lookups into one query per request; when disabled, each record triggers its own database call and latency climbs fast. Check that the service was restarted after deploy. The relevant settings are shown below.

settings of fafog-haduf:
ZORIX_PIN=4648
ZORIX_METRICS_HOST=metrics.zorix.paliqsys.corp
ZORIX_LOG_LEVEL=info
ZORIX_TENANT=druix